Friday the president of Colombia Juan Manuel Santos, announced in an interview that is about to legalize marijuana for medicinal use.
"I hope in the next three to four days," he said the Colombian president told local media.
"It is scientifically proven that marijuana has medicinal attributes much," he added.
The decree regulates the possession of seeds and plants, production, distribution, sale, possession and export.
This is a key point, because as Santos said, "there is a great demand, there are companies in Canada and the United States who are using marijuana for an amount of therapeutic drug treatments."
